slide would not come in

07 Beaver Marquies 3 slides. Front passenger slide motor would run but slide wouldn't move. Checked and power to the valves on the motor. My 04 Marquie did same thing and it was an diode in the wireing that caused the motor to change directions. Called Beaver and they didn't think this coach had that type system. I have a power gear leveling system. After unplugging the wires to the valves to test for power it started working. Works fine now but afraid it will happen again. Anyone have any ideas?? Tough to find out what is wrong when it is working?? Any help much appreciated.

This may or may not help with your problem but I've done this several times. Many years ago 4 of us were fly fishing in Feb here in AR. It was cold but still good fishing. At that time we had a 34' DS 1999. It only had one slide but it was a big one (couch/kitchen). When we decided to break camp the slide would not come in. It seemed to want to work but wouldn't move. So I lowered the MH jacks on the opposite side which created a downward slope and the slide moved right in with not single glitch.

The slide on that MH when it almost reached its full out position also dropped down so the inner edge was level with the floor. I don't know if many or any MH's these days still utilize that little added feature. When it came in it first had to lift the slide then move it in.

I think you may have a slide solenoid that is failing. We had the same thing, the motor would run but the slide was reluctant, then finally just quit. Replaced the solenoid on the pump motor under the steps and all is good. A possibility. I believe we have the same HWH slide system.
